Top 10 most expensive homes sold in Placer County foothills last week?
A house in Auburn that sold for $2 million tops the list of the most expensive real estate sales in Placer County foothills in the past week.
In total, 44 real estate sales were registered in the area during the last week, with an average price of $1.5 million. The average price per square foot ended up at $372.
The prices in the list below concern real estate sales where the title was created during the week of June 13, even if the property may have been sold earlier.
